欢迎来到科站长!

MsSql

当前位置: 主页 > 数据库 > MsSql

如何正确命名和修改MSSQL数据库表名?详细SQL操作指南!

时间:2026-02-12 10:03:55|栏目:MsSql|点击:

mysql怎么建立表的方法

1、基本语法结构使用CREATE TABLE语句定义表名及列信息,语法如下:CREATE TABLE table_name ( column1 datatype constraints, column2 datatype constraints, ... columnN datatype constraints);表名:需遵循命名规范(如小写字母、下划线分隔),避免使用MySQL保留字。

2、使用命令行工具(如mysql -u 用户名 -p)或图形化界面(如MySQL Workbench、phpMyAdmin)登录数据库服务器。确保已选择目标数据库(通过USE 数据库名;命令或图形界面切换)。定义表结构(CREATE TABLE语句)使用CREATE TABLE 表名 (字段定义);语法定义表名和字段。

3、明确业务需求并设计表结构分析业务需求:确定表需要存储哪些数据,例如用户信息、订单数据等。设计字段:根据需求确定字段名称、数据类型、长度和约束条件。考虑扩展性:预留未来可能需要的字段,避免频繁修改表结构。

4、在MySQL中创建表需通过CREATE TABLE语句定义表结构,核心要素包括字段名、数据类型、约束条件、索引及扩展性设计。

5、Navicat for MySQL 是一款图形化数据库管理工具,以下是其使用方法及建库、建表、插入数据的详细步骤:准备工作 确保已安装 Navicat for MySQL 和 MySQL 服务。启动 MySQL 服务:通过命令行输入 net start mysql(需管理员权限)。或在任务管理器的“服务”选项卡中找到 MySQL 右键启动。

mysql如何给查询结果起别名

在 MySQL 中,可以通过 AS 关键字 或 直接命名 的方式为查询结果的列、表达式或表设置别名,使输出结果更清晰易读。

AS关键字的基本功能AS关键字的核心作用是为列或表创建别名,使查询结果更直观,简化复杂查询的编写。别名在查询结果中替代原始列名或表名显示,但不会改变数据库中的实际名称。列别名的使用方法列别名主要用于使查询结果更易读,尤其在列名较长或需要显示更友好的名称时。

高级用法子查询别名:在复杂查询中,子查询结果集可通过别名引用。

语法:在FROM子句中使用表名 AS 别名的形式为表指定别名。例如,FROM article AS a。作用:简化查询:使用表别名可以使SQL查询语句更加简洁。提高可读性:通过为表指定有意义的别名,可以提高SQL查询语句的可读性。

一次说清楚mysql的lower_case_table_names参数设置和数据库表名称大小写...

MySQL的lower_case_table_names参数用于控制在数据库存储和比较表名时的大小写敏感性。该参数的设置对数据库的操作、备份及迁移等均有重要影响。以下是关于lower_case_table_names参数的详细解释及在不同操作系统下的默认值。

在处理完毕大小写问题后,建议将表名统一为小写,以增强代码可读性和一致性。完成表名调整或删除大写表名后,可将`lower_case_table_names`参数恢复为默认值1,确保所有表名以小写形式被识别和访问。

MySQL服务器全局大小写设置全局设置通过两个关键参数控制:lower_case_table_names和sql_mode。lower_case_table_names参数该参数决定数据库和表名的大小写敏感规则:0:区分大小写(Linux/Unix默认值,需在初始化前设置,否则可能导致启动失败)。

mysql创建一个空表

在 MySQL 中创建表格需要以下步骤:连接到数据库服务器。选择要创建表格的数据库。使用 CREATE TABLE 语句创建新表格,指定表格名、列名、数据类型和主键。使用 SHOW TABLES 命令验证表格是否成功创建。如何创建 MySQL 表格在 MySQL 中创建表格是一个基本操作,可以存储和管理数据。

创建一个表。表名字Persons,第一列Id_P,整数类型;第二列LASTName,字符类型;第三列FirstName,字符类型。

明确业务需求并设计表结构分析业务需求:确定表需要存储哪些数据,例如用户信息、订单数据等。设计字段:根据需求确定字段名称、数据类型、长度和约束条件。考虑扩展性:预留未来可能需要的字段,避免频繁修改表结构。

MySQL中使用表别名与字段别名的基本教程

语法:在FROM子句中使用表名 AS 别名的形式为表指定别名。例如,FROM article AS a。作用:简化查询:使用表别名可以使SQL查询语句更加简洁。提高可读性:通过为表指定有意义的别名,可以提高SQL查询语句的可读性。

替代方案:-- 错误:WHERE中使用别名SELECT first_name AS fname FROM employees WHERE fname = John; -- 正确:使用原始列名SELECT first_name AS fname FROM employees WHERE first_name = John;高级技巧计算字段别名对表达式结果指定别名,便于后续引用或排序。

基本语法:SELECT 列名 FROM 表名 AS 别名示例:SELECT e.first_name, e.last_name, d.department_nameFROM employees AS eJOIN departments AS d ON e.department_id = d.id;效果:在后续查询中可以使用简短的e和d代替完整的表名employees和departments。

在MySQL中,AS关键字主要用于为列或表创建临时名称(别名),以提高查询结果的可读性、简化多表操作,并优化代码结构。 列别名的应用核心作用:为计算列、表达式或复杂字段名提供有意义的名称,使结果更直观。

MySQL数据库不支持使用中文命名表和字段名mysql不能写中文名

1、MySQL数据库是一种非常流行的开源数据库管理系统,它支持多种数据类型和功能非常丰富。但是,MySQL不支持使用中文来命名表和字段名称,这是因为MySQL是一种由英文编写而成的数据库系统,它的源码中都是使用英文字符。在MySQL中,只支持使用英文字母、数字和下划线来命名表和字段名称。

2、其中table_name为需要修改的表名称)这种方法可以让数据库和表的字符集使用UTF-8,解决中文字符显示问题。方法三:使用SET NAMES命令 如果不想修改MySQL的默认字符集或数据库、表的字符集,还可以在每次连接MySQL时使用SET NAMES命令设置字符集。

3、通过修改MySQL服务器的字符集并将表中的每个列更改为utf8mb4字符集,我们可以解决MySQL无法写入中文字符的问题。使用utf8mb4字符集允许 MySQL 存储任何Unicode字符,包括中文和其他语言字符。使用本文中提供的解决方法,你可以在MySQL中正确地写入中文字符。

4、方法四:在连接字符串中设置字符集 最后一种方法是在连接字符串中设置字符集。

5、如果MySQL已经存在了,或者MySQL的字符集已经设置完成,而且数据表中的数据的字符集还是不能包含中文的话,就需要单独的修改该表的字符集。

上一篇:k3mssql究竟是什么?为何在数据库领域备受关注?

栏    目:MsSql

下一篇:mssql数据库有哪些具体用途?与sql数据库相比有何独特之处?

本文标题:如何正确命名和修改MSSQL数据库表名?详细SQL操作指南!

本文地址:https://fushidao.cc/shujuku/54637.html

广告投放 | 联系我们 | 版权申明

作者声明:本站作品含AI生成内容,所有的文章、图片、评论等,均由网友发表或百度AI生成内容,属个人行为,与本站立场无关。

如果侵犯了您的权利,请与我们联系,我们将在24小时内进行处理、任何非本站因素导致的法律后果,本站均不负任何责任。

联系QQ:66551466 | 邮箱:66551466@qq.com

Copyright © 2018-2026 科站长 版权所有鄂ICP备2024089280号